Dubai Case Study: Eliminating IT AMC Downtime with Managed IT Services (2025)
A Dubai-based SME transitioned from reactive IT AMC support to a proactive managed IT model to address recurring outages, delayed response times, and unmanaged legacy infrastructure.
Key Observations
- Average IT downtime reduced by 90%+ within six months
- Mean time to resolution (MTTR) improved by 3.2×
- IT operational expenditure reduced by 30–40%
Focus Areas
- Managed IT services
- SLA-driven support
- Downtime elimination
DIFC Case Study: Securing Legal Data with Managed IT Services (2025)
A DIFC-regulated legal environment required secure document management, controlled data sharing, and continuous monitoring to meet data protection obligations.
Key Observations
- 100% audit compliance with DIFC Data Protection Law
- Security incident detection reduced from days to minutes
- Zero incidents of unauthorized document leakage
Focus Areas
- Legal IT security
- Information protection
- Regulatory compliance

DIFC FinTech Case Study: Zero-Trust Managed IT & Regulatory Compliance (2025)
A DIFC-licensed FinTech adopted a zero-trust IT model to secure distributed teams, APIs, and multi-cloud environments under DFSA guidelines.
Key Observations
- 70% reduction in incident impact via micro-segmentation
- VPNs replaced with Zero-Trust Network Access (ZTNA)
- Developer onboarding time reduced from 3 days to 4 hours
Focus Areas
- FinTech IT
- Zero-trust security
- Regulatory alignment

Dubai Case Study: Warehouse Wi-Fi Redesign for a DIP Logistics Hub (2025)
A logistics warehouse operating in Dubai Investment Park (DIP) faced frequent wireless dropouts, slow barcode scanning, and unreliable connectivity across racking aisles and loading bays, impacting inventory accuracy and dispatch speed.
Key Observations
- Wireless coverage stabilized across 99%+ of warehouse floor space
- Order processing and dispatch speed improved by 20–25%
- Seamless roaming enabled uninterrupted handheld and VoIP usage
Focus Areas
- Warehouse Wi-Fi redesign
- Logistics mobility infrastructure
- High-density wireless coverage
